Dodge Magnum
TThe Magnum name was
revived in 2004 as a 2005 station wagon on
Chrysler's LX platform. This is Dodge's first
station wagon since the discontinuation of
the Dodge Colt wagon in 1991. The
new Magnum has three engine options, the SE
features the 190 hp 2.7 L LH V6, the SXT has
the 250 hp 3.5 L V6, and the RT has the new
5.7 L Hemi V8. The Magnum will also be available
with all wheel drive in 2005 on SXT and RT
models. The AWD SXT and the RT use a Mercedes-Benz-derived
5-speed automatic transmission, while all
other models use a four-speed automatic.
Like the Chrysler 300,
the new Magnum has been a stunning success
for the company, easily outselling its predecessor,
the Dodge Intrepid. Dodge has announced plans
for the Magnum to go on sale as a police variant
to compete against the Ford Crown Victoria.
Available only to law enforcement, emergency
agencies, and government agencies, the vehicle
will have the SXT's V6 as a base motor and
the Hemi as an option, along with police-specific
options such as a steering-column mounted
shifter, deactivated interior rear windows
and locks, and bulletproof glass between the
first and second rows of seats and the cargo
area. The Magnum is built in Brampton, Ontario,
Canada.
